MediaTek just announced the new chipset series for flagship smartphones. Dimensity 8000 series gets announced. The series consists of 2 chipsets, the Dimensity 8000 and the Dimensity 8100. This time the chips are more focused on efficiency rather than performance boost.
Dimensity 8000 Series
The main focus of MediaTek with this series is to deliver the performance of the Dimensity 9000 series in a smaller and more efficient package.
Dimensity 8000 SoC
The 8000 chipset uses the TSMC 5nm process to build, an eight-core architecture design. The CPU contains four 2.75GHz Cortex-A78 large core and four 2.0GHz A55 energy-efficient smaller cores, with a cache of 4MB L3. In the graphics department, the chipset spots a six-core Arm Mali-G610 integrated GPU. The GPU is equipped with HyperEngine 5.0 game optimization engine, APU by two performance cores and one general-purpose core.
Moreover, The network capability is 2CC multi-carrier aggregation. 200Mhz. The theoretical downlink rate will be 4.7Gbps. It also supports 5G UltraSave 2.0 power-saving technology.
Furthermore, for the camera. It supports a 3 x 14bit ISP, which means it is processing 5 billion pixels per second. Dual & Triple camera support can also be observed. Adding to that, it also supports Imagiq 780 camera, 4K video recording. Here the power consumption is 30% lower. However, other features like HDR, AI Blur, AI N.R can also be seen.
Dimensity 8100 SoC
The 8100 as the name suggest will be the upper model of the 8000 series. It is based on the same TSMC 5nm foundry. CPU cores are the same, but the core frequency of the large cores is 2.85GHz, making it, four 2.85GHz Cortex-A78 large cores and four 2.0GHz A55 energy-efficient cores.
In addition to that, the GPU provides 20% higher performance while the APU has shown 25% improvement. This also makes it support a WQHD+ 120Hz display. The rest is similar to Dimensity 8000.
Phones Supporting the Chipsets
Some phone manufacturers have already announced their future phones with this chipset. Oppo is going to use this new series in its Oppo K10 series. Realme also joined the game saying that the GT Neo 3 and the K50 series will be getting these new chipsets. Lastly, OnePlus without revealing the name, said that a future smartphone will use a Dimensity 8000 series chipset.
